Joseph Metcalf School, a rural-scale middle school in Holyoke, Massachusetts, operated by Holyoke, enrolls 213 students, covering grades 6 through 8. Compared to the state average of about 547 students per school, that is 61% leaner than typical.
Holyoke comprises 10 schools with combined enrollment of 4,795 students; Joseph Metcalf School is among them.
On demographics, Joseph Metcalf School lists that 81%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. Beyond that, the school reports 11% White, 4% Black, 2%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 27% Hispanic, putting the school's mix visibly more Hispanic than the area baseline.
In terms of school funding signals, Staff filings list 22 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 9.9:1 students per teacher.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 11.5:1 average.
Around the school, the surrounding county (Hampden County) records that the typical household earns roughly $71,306 per year, about 29%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 12%. In all, Hampden County runs 168 public schools (combined enrollment of about 68,540 students), of which Joseph Metcalf School is one.
The closest other public school is Holyoke Community Charter School, roughly 0.5 miles away.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Joseph Metcalf School.
Joseph Metcalf School operates from a suburban location.
Looking at the recent track record. Joseph Metcalf School's enrollment has ticked down 18% since 2018, when it stood at 259 (now 213). Over the same period, the Hispanic share climbed from 54% to 81%. Class-load math has pulled in: from 18.6:1 in 2018 to 9.9:1 in 2025.
